Hi, I remember seeing mod maps with two types of mod maps. Some times there are two mod maps one for mac players and one for pc players. I was wondering what the difference between the two are, and how is a mac mod map made?
Mac and PC mods have no differences for Mac and PC. a mod is used by the engine in the exact same way.
however, some people write installers for the mods themselves, these often do not work on the other system, so they end up making a "mac" or "pc" version without the installer. That is the only time i've seen Mac or PC versions of mods.

There is clearly a difference in the maps I have that have two folders for the same map. One is a pc map with similar files like any other map. But the other folder has folder and files like _MACOSX and ._dra5.lvl. I am just wanting to know more about this.
Those are temporary files that are left behind. In Windows, they aren't hidden. That probably means that whoever made the archive of that map did so in OSX.
It doesn't affect the map or the compatibility. You're safe to delete those files.
